Here A Father, There A Father
This past Sunday was Father's Day and what best way to spend the time than to be with your good ol' dad. Me? I had to calculate how much time to spend with each one in the family, taking into account distance to travel, gasoline prices and meal times!
First we headed towards the middle of nowhere in Puerto Rico: Barranquitas. There my brother's financeé's parents were having a Father's Day party at their ranch. Don't get me wrong; the place is amazing. My only problem is that it's a 2 hour drive through woods and mountains. Even my poor wife got a bit queasy from the trip. We arrived at 3PM and how long did we stay? 2 hours.
We then headed southeast to take the expressway to Caguas, left my wife's mom some pumpkins we got at the ranch as gifts, and then drove up back to Guaynabo to spend some time with my dad's side of the family. We arrived at 6:30PM and how long did we stay? 2 hours.
Finally, we went to Cupey and visited my wife's uncle and aunt where we chatted a bit and watched a baseball game. We arrived at 9PM and, you guessed it, left 2 hours later.
Quite an exhausting Father's Day if you ask me. Now to build up energy for the next holiday. It's a good thing Christmas is still half a year away!
